Explain how this quote helps to support Rothman's suggestion that we all desire a "Great Romance."

English
1 answer:
Orlov [11]3 years ago
5 0

Here's the suggestion made by Rothman;

"It’s a familiar wish—we all want to be loved perfectly and forever—and it makes for a great story; there’s something admirable in it, and, along with Nick, you wonder whether a Great Romance might complete your life".

Explanation:

He tries to liken the characters portrayed in the Great Gatsby to real life. For example, Gatsby desire for love is one that is shared by many today who wish to love and to be loved.

Thus, the story captivates the interests of so many readers as it portrays the love fantasies of Gatsby.

QUICK HURRY PLEASE<br><br> List the three elements of a conclusion to an argumentative essay.
dimulka [17.4K]

Answer: The conclusion of an essay has three major parts: Answer: the thesis statement, revisited. Summary: main points and highlights from the body paragraphs. Significance: the relevance and implications of the essay's findings.
